By REBECCA MUSHOTA –
President Lungu 628x350PRESIDENT Lungu has said the Zambian society is unique because people from different parts of the country easily live in harmony.
He said Zambians from different parts of the country married each other without any uneasiness.
“The Zambian society is unique because of the ‘One Zambia One Nation’ motto. People from different parts of the country get married without any qualms at all,” Mr Lungu said.
The Head of State said this in a message relayed on his behalf by Justice Minister Ngosa Simbyakula at the wedding ceremony of the President’s official photographer Salim Henry and Evelyn Tembo at the Zambia National Service Chamba Valley banquet hall in Lusaka on Saturday evening.
Mr Lungu said the newly-weds were each other’s keeper now that they were married.
He said as a couple, they would go through tribulations and that it was in such times that they should turn to God for his intervention.
He said the couple should enjoy each other’s company for many years from now.
The groom’s family representative Lastone Mumba said he was grateful for the support that his nephew Salim had received.
He said friends had proved over time that they were as good or even better than family members.
Mr Mumba wished the couple well as they started life together.
The father of the bride, Versacious Phiri said the two should learn to say ‘sorry and thank you’ and to seek permission in order to have a wonderful marriage.
Mr Phiri said he was happy to see the two get married because he had known Mr Henry since he was a child.
